Is easy off oven cleaner toxic?

Yes, Easy-Off oven cleaner contains toxic chemicals such as lye (sodium hydroxide) and can be harmful if ingested or inhaled. It is important to follow the safety instructions on the product label and use the cleaner in a well-ventilated area to minimize exposure to the fumes.

What is the ingredients in Hoppes 9 Solvent?

Hoppe's No. 9 Gun Bore Cleaner contains a blend of petroleum distillates, kerosene, and ethyl alcohol that work together to effectively break down and remove fouling, residue, and corrosion from gun barrels. It is important to use this solvent in a well-ventilated area and follow safety precautions as indicated on the product label.

What safety precautions should be taken when using an acidic household cleaner?

When using an acidic household cleaner, it is important to wear gloves and eye protection to prevent skin and eye irritation. Make sure to work in a well-ventilated area to avoid inhaling fumes, and never mix acidic cleaners with other chemicals as it can create harmful reactions. Additionally, always read and follow the instructions on the product label carefully to ensure safe usage.


What are the potential risks associated with using ammonia cleaner in a poorly ventilated area?

Using ammonia cleaner in a poorly ventilated area can pose health risks due to the strong fumes it releases. Breathing in these fumes can irritate the respiratory system, eyes, and skin, leading to symptoms like coughing, shortness of breath, and skin irritation. Prolonged exposure to high levels of ammonia fumes can cause more serious health issues, such as lung damage or even chemical burns. It is important to always use ammonia cleaner in a well-ventilated area to minimize these risks.


Can you neutralize rooto drain cleaner with salt if it gets on your skin?

Rooto drain cleaner is a strong alkali product, not an acid, so salt won't neutralize it. Rinse the affected area with water for at least 15 minutes and seek medical attention if irritation persists. Avoid using household items for first aid and follow safety instructions on the product label.
